Episode synopsis
When Donald Dunlear destroys school property, his counselor sends him to Dr. Graham - who decides to hold a family therapy session.
About The Eleventh Hour
The Eleventh Hour is an American medical drama about psychiatry starring Wendell Corey, Jack Ging, and Ralph Bellamy, which aired sixty-two new episodes plus selected rebroadcasts on NBC from October 3, 1962, to September 9, 1964.
